使用一体式安装程序升级 Apache Tomcat (Windows)
Apache Tomcat 是运行 ESET PROTECT Web Console 所需的必需组件。 使用此方法来通过使用最新的 ESET PROTECT On-Prem 11.1 一体式安装程序升级 Apache Tomcat。 如果现有 Apache Tomcat 安装是通过一体式安装程序执行的,这是建议的升级选项。 此外,也可以手动升级 Apache Tomcat。
升级之前
备份以下文件:
C:\Program Files\Apache Software Foundation\[ Tomcat 文件夹 ]\.keystore
C:\Program Files\Apache Software Foundation\[ Tomcat 文件夹 ]\conf\server.xml
C:\Program Files\Apache Software Foundation\[ Tomcat 文件夹 ]\webapps\era\WEB-INF\classes\sk\eset\era\g2webconsole\server\modules\config\EraWebServerConfig.properties
如果使用的是 Tomcat 文件夹中的自定义 SSL 证书存储,也请备份该证书。
Apache Tomcat 和 Web 控制台升级限制 •如果安装了自定义版本的 Apache Tomcat(Tomcat 服务的手动安装),则通过一体式安装程序或通过组件升级任务的后续 ESET PROTECT Web 控制台升级不受支持。 •Apache Tomcat 升级会删除位于以下位置的 era 文件夹: C:\Program Files\Apache Software Foundation\[ Tomcat 文件夹 ]\webapps\.如果使用 era 文件夹存储其他数据,请确保在升级之前先备份相应数据。 •如果 C:\Program Files\Apache Software Foundation\[ Tomcat 文件夹 ]\webapps\ 中包含其他数据(而非 era 和 ROOT 文件夹),则 Apache Tomcat 升级将不会进行,而仅会升级 Web 控制台。 •Web 控制台和 Apache Tomcat 升级会清除脱机帮助文件。如果使用了早期版本的 ESET PROTECT On-Prem 的脱机帮助,请在升级后为 ESET PROTECT On-Prem 11.1 重新创建它,以确保您有匹配 ESET PROTECT On-Prem 版本的最新脱机帮助。 |
升级过程
1.从 ESET 网站下载 ESET PROTECT 一体式安装程序,然后解压缩该下载文件。
2.如果要安装最新版本的 Apache Tomcat,但一体式安装程序包含较旧版本的 Apache Tomcat(此步骤可选 - 如果不需要最新版本的 Apache Tomcat,请跳到步骤 4):
a.打开 x64 文件夹,然后导航到 installers 文件夹。
b.删除位于 installers 文件夹中的 apache-tomcat-9.0.x-windows-x64.zip 文件.
c.下载 Apache Tomcat 9 64 位 Windows zip 程序包。
d.将下载的 zip 程序包移动到 installers 文件夹。
3.要启动一体式安装程序,请双击 Setup.exe 文件,然后在欢迎屏幕中单击下一步。
4.选择升级所有组件,然后单击下一步。
5.接受 EULA 后,单击下一步。
6.如果升级可用,将自动检测一体式安装程序:在可升级的 ESET PROTECT 组件旁边有复选框。单击下一步。
7.在计算机上选择 Java 安装。 Apache Tomcat 需要 64 位 Java/OpenJDK。 如果在系统上安装了多个 Java 版本,建议您卸载较早的 Java 版本并仅保留最新的受支持的 Java 版本。
从 2019 年 1 月开始,面向企业、商业或生产用途的 Oracle JAVA SE 8 公开更新将需要商业许可证。如果不购买 JAVA SE 订阅,可以使用本指南来转换为免费替代方案。请参阅 JDK 的受支持版本。 |
8.单击升级以完成该升级,然后单击完成。
9. 如果在不是 ESET PROTECT 服务器的其他计算机上安装了 Web 控制台:
a. 停用 Apache Tomcat 服务。导航到启动 > 服务 > 右键单击 Apache Tomcat 服务并选择停止。
b.将 EraWebServerConfig.properties 文件(从步骤 1)恢复到其原始位置。
c. 启动 Apache Tomcat 服务:导航到启动 > 服务 > 右键单击 Apache Tomcat 服务并选择启动。
10. 连接到 ESET PROTECT Web 控制台并验证是否正确加载了 Web 控制台。
故障排除
如果升级 Apache Tomcat 失败,请卸载 Apache Tomcat,然后重新安装它并应用步骤 1 中的配置。